Okay let's get serious here, Do you mean System Restore or System Recovery?.
There a lot of Difference and confusion here, the system Restore can be
access from:
Start >> All programs >. accessories >> System Tools >> System Restore, a
calender will open and you have three choices:
( ) Restore my computer to an earlier time
( ) Create s restore point
( ) Undo my last restoration

So if you done a Restore to an earlier date choice, you can undo it.

If you start the System Recovery and recovered your system to Factory
settings then you are under Arrest (just joking) you lost all restore Points
for good!.
